Mount Vernon council accepts $2.704 million CREST grant for Dole Center renovations
On Sept. 10 the Mount Vernon City Council voted to authorize the mayor to accept a CREST grant awarded by the Dormitory Authority of the State of New York (DASNY) in the amount of $2,704,000 for renovations at the Dole Center.

The ordinance authorizing acceptance of the CREST funds was moved, seconded and approved by unanimous roll call vote. Council members voting aye included Councilman Boxhill, Councilwoman Gleeson, Councilman Poteet, Councilman Thompson and Council President Brown.

Why it matters: The $2.704 million award is designated for renovations at a city facility and represents a significant capital improvement funded through a state authority program. The measure passed as part of the council's legislative agenda on Sept. 10.

Related items: At the same meeting council members also discussed, and in some cases approved, other departmental ordinances, personnel leaves and training attendances; a separate ordinance authorizing a vehicle‑fleet agreement was held on the floor for further information.

Implementation: The ordinance delegates acceptance of the grant to the mayor; the Department of Public Works and mayoral office will be responsible for carrying out renovations and any procurement steps tied to the DASNY grant terms.
